我试图打开一个像 David Planella 在这里描述的那样的对话框(并快速帮助添加): 打开自定义对话框窗口(PyGTK + Quickly)
但这对我来说不起作用。如果我打开创建的对话框,我总是收到相同的错误消息:
AttributeError: 'module' object has no attribute 'NewDialogNameDialog'
(注意:我的 Dialog-Name 被替换为“NewDialogNameDialog”以更加通用。)我尝试测试 Ubuntu 应用程序对决的教程以学习如何快速使用 python。
如果您愿意,我也可以添加整个源代码。
答案1
我认为他的例子中有一个拼写错误。类和模块应该具有相同的名称。因此,不要这样写:
DialogNameDialog.NewDialogNameDialog()
它可能是:
DialogNameDialog.DialogNameDialog()
(即删除“New”)
如果这不起作用,我希望尽可能查看这两个文件。